Revision Management with Insurrection and Subversion

To access the repositories below via a web browser, just click on the links.  You may be asked to enter your username and password to get access to restricted repositories.

Repository NameLogin(Read Only)
cache-scriptsRSS Feed of activity in repository cache-scriptsAtom Feed of activity in repository cache-scriptsRepository for scripts to generate pacman cache files from the cache repository
cacheRSS Feed of activity in repository cacheAtom Feed of activity in repository cacheRepository for pacman cache files for the VTB pacman cache
configurationRSS Feed of activity in repository configurationAtom Feed of activity in repository configurationRepository for configure-osg replacement
itb-testingRSS Feed of activity in repository itb-testingAtom Feed of activity in repository itb-testingRepository for scripts for itb testing and monitoring
itbRSS Feed of activity in repository itbAtom Feed of activity in repository itbRepository for itb pacman files
jobmonitorRSS Feed of activity in repository jobmonitorAtom Feed of activity in repository jobmonitorRepository for itb jobmonitor project
osg-repositoryRSS Feed of activity in repository osg-repositoryAtom Feed of activity in repository osg-repositoryRepository for scripts that may be of use to the osg community
repositoriesRSS Feed of activity in repository repositoriesAtom Feed of activity in repository repositoriesRepository for all pacman files
syslog-ngRSS Feed of activity in repository syslog-ngAtom Feed of activity in repository syslog-ngRepository for syslog-ng scripts
testpilotRSS Feed of activity in repository testpilotAtom Feed of activity in repository testpilotRepository for testpilot project
troubleshootingRSS Feed of activity in repository troubleshootingAtom Feed of activity in repository troubleshootingRepository for scripts for OSG troubleshooting team
validationRSS Feed of activity in repository validationAtom Feed of activity in repository validationRepository for scripts to generate the VTB validation table
vtb-scriptsRSS Feed of activity in repository vtb-scriptsAtom Feed of activity in repository vtb-scriptsRepository for scripts for OSG VTB use

To access the repositories above via Subversion, browse to the location in the repository you want via your web browser and then use that URL with your favorite Subversion client tool.  You may asked to enter your username and password for access to any restricted repositories.

Note:  You should normally not check out the whole repository from the root as it may contain many tags and/or branches.

[Valid Atom]
[Valid RSS]
Atom and RSS feeds are available for activity in a repository or sub-tree of a repository.  The Atom and RSS link buttons you will see while browsing the repositories will produce a feed for that part of the repository.

The Atom feed has been validated to conform to the Atom 1.0 IETF standard and RFC-4287.

The RSS feed has been validated to conform to the RSS 2.0 specification.

Both feeds support HTTP "Conditional GET" operation via the the HTTP ETag/If-None-Match headers to reduce bandwidth and system overhead when there are no new updates since the last download of the feed.  Most feed readers and browsers support this.  You can read more about it at this blog and in the HTTP specification.

Some resources that are located on this server.

The Insurrection Project The Insurrection project information page - the code that we developed for our service.
Browser Test Pages Some simple browser compatibility test pages for the Insurrection Web Tools.
Apache mod_rewrite Tests It seems that certain URL patterns do not get processed correctly within mod_rewrite in Apache 2.0.54
My Subversion Quick-Start Some introductory documentation about Subversion and the revision control rules and procedures that I follow.

Some resources that we think are useful for working with Code-Host services.

The Subversion Project The Subversion project home page
The Subversion Book The Subversion Book - a freely available, very good book on using Subversion.  Also published by O'Reilly Media.
The Insurrection Project The Insurrection project information page - the code that we developed for our service.
The Subversion Project Links The Subversion related links page from the Subversion Project

About Us

Code-Host.net by MKSoft Development provides reliable & secure hosted document and code revision management services via the internet.  The service is built on industry leading technologies: Cisco firewalls, Linux servers, Apache webservers, Subversion repositories, and the Insurrection web interface.

The Code-Host.net servers are high-quality, carrier grade servers that are co-located in high-security, high-bandwidth data centers.  The repositories on the servers are backed up nightly to a secured backup system with at least two generations of complete backups available.  For that extra level of security, each server is secured behind a dedicated external firewall in addition to the server's internal firewall.

MKSoft Development provides advanced internet and computer technology consulting services.  MKSoft Development has a full range of revision management solutions ranging from basic network hosted revision management accounts to full custom integrated systems at customer sites.  We have built custom revision management and software build solutions for over 15 years for a variety of environments using various proven and stable technologies.  Reliability and security are always critical concerns, especially for revision management systems.

Michael Sinz has been in the technology and software industry since 1979.  In addition to his commercial work, he has been contributing to "open source" for much of that time.